Lance Armstrong’s estimated net worth in 2025 is approximately $50 million. This figure encapsulates a journey marked by remarkable achievements, profound struggles, and a resilient comeback within the financial realm.
Armstrong gained fame as a dominant cyclist, having clinched seven Tour de France titles and amassing around $20 million in prize winnings between 1999 and 2005. At the peak of his career, he earned about $10 million annually through various prizes and endorsements, securing deals with major brands like Nike and Trek Bikes, which once contributed approximately $15 million to his income annually. However, his admission of doping violations in 2012 led to significant financial repercussions, including the loss of sponsorships and a tarnished reputation.
In a testament to his financial acumen and adaptability, Armstrong has shifted focus from cycling to entrepreneurship. His $100,000 investment in Uber is now valued at around $20 million, showcasing his ability to identify promising opportunities outside of sports. Additionally, his podcast, which delves into sports culture, generates about $1.5 million per year, alongside another $1 million from motivational speaking engagements.
Armstrong enjoys a luxurious lifestyle, owning a sprawling 6,000-acre ranch in Texas and a $5 million mansion equipped with advanced training facilities. His assets also include a collection of high-value vehicles and a yacht estimated at $3 million. He emphasizes the importance of balance in life, stating, “Family, privacy, and peace of mind matter just as much as success.”
Despite the controversies surrounding his past, Armstrong remains in the public eye, recently launching a podcast featuring renowned athletes and entrepreneurs, and collaborating with Jay-Z to produce a documentary focusing on themes of redemption and resilience. His involvement in the cycling community continues, as evidenced by his presence at events like the 2025 Tour de France finale.
Armstrong’s journey reflects not only his initial triumphs but also a narrative of personal growth and reinvention. His current financial status represents a blending of athletic legacy with new ventures, underscoring a commendable capacity for perseverance amidst adversity. Armstrong aptly concludes, “It’s not how many times you fall, but how many times you get back up.” This resilience is a powerful message for many facing their own challenges.